Simpson was still an a Flor when he filmed do la a to movie with Elizabeth Montgomery in �?T77.movie actor Simpson enters his next stage by Vernon Scott up Hollywood reporter. As a motion picture actor . Simpson never attained the sort of stardom he enjoyed on the Gridiron. In Short the likeable affable Simpson was a far better athlete than actor. Still he has accomplished More on the screen than any other football Star turned actor at least in movies. His career overshadows that of onetime los Angeles ram All pro Merlin Olsen who starred in a couple of to series and appeared in an occasional movie role. Alex Karras the fearsome linebacker for the Detroit Lions also had his Day in the Sun As a to series Star. Fred dryer starred in Hunter for seven years on the tube and continues to produce and Star in television movies. Fred Williamson has had a steady career As a film writer producer director and actor James Brown Bubba Smith and a handful of other sex footballers have made marginal livings from acting. But none of them matched Simpson As a popular football player who became a Hollywood performer. He was and remains a legend for his Gridiron feats As an undergraduate at Southern Cal and As a record setting running Back in the National football league. A Hall of Famer. Many another football Flash has tried his hand at acting with Little Success Don Meredith and Joe Namath to name two. There were some movie stars who played football to be sure John Wayne Burt Reynolds Ronald Reagan and others but that is a different Story. Simpson who posed no threat to become an Oscar contender for Best actor nevertheless has starred in or played character roles in at least a dozen movies. The most successful of his dramatic films was the towering inferno in 1974 with Steve Mcqueen Paul Newman William Holden and Faye Dunaway. He a was seen in a minor role As a Security guard. He also played dramatic parts in the Klansman the Diamond mercenaries Capricorn one firepower and the Cassandra crossing. Simpson played a supporting role in the major miniseries roots in 1977. He starred in the to movies Detour Goldie and the Boxer and Goldie and the Boxer go to Hollywood plus a killing affair. But it was in comedy that Simpson gave his Best performances especially As a Dunder headed cop in the naked gun from the files of police squad and the sequel the naked gun 2 a the smell of tear. Simpson was a smiling Happy camper on movie sets confident and at ease with playing make by live. He was approachable on sound stages and in studio commissaries. As at us and with the Buffalo Bills and san Francisco 49ers, Simpson was a team player on movie companies. He enjoyed running lines with fellow cast members swapping jokes and anecdotes Between scenes. He was universally popular with Cali of the casts and Crews with which he worked in films and television. He was praised for his even temper and Coop Calion with directors. Simpson loved to talk football with fellow actors almost All of whom admired his Grace and courage As an athlete. During an interview with up Early in his acting career 0 j. Was asked How he managed to play so Many years without major injuries. He laughed and said ill m big boned it hurts the Guys who tackle me More than it hurts me. A anyhow i had 10 teammates knocking Down the opposing team. And Don t forget i was running around the other Guys not trying to run Over them. A acting is a lot More dangerous than playing Ball if you ask me. When you make a mistake on the Field it in t As noticeable and you go on to the next play. If you blow your lines in a movie everybody has to Stop and Start Over again until you get it right. A that really hurts when you know you re taking up time and costing folks a lot of  Simpson had a reputation for being a natural actor although his elocution never measured up to say Anthony Hopkins. But the same was True of Mcqueen who became a Good Friend. For three years from 1983 to 1985, Simpson worked As an analyst in the Booth for abcs monday night football. In recent years he was a member of no cd a pregame show with Bob Costas a Job he held at the time of his arrest on murder charges in the slayings of his sex wife Nicole Brown Simpson and her Friend Ronald Lyle Goldman. Now Simpson finds himself cast in the most difficult role of his life. No matter what the outcome of the Case nothing in his careers As athlete broadcaster or actor could prepare him for what he faces in the immediate  John Young Waco Texas Tribune Herald.
